Uganda's High Commissioner to Kenya Hassan Wasswa Dies in Nairobi

Uganda’s High Commissioner to Kenya Hassan Wasswa Galiwango has died in Nairobi after a short illness.

Wasswa, who doubled up as Uganda′s High Commissioner to Seychelles, passed away while undergoing treatment at Nairobi Hospital.

His death was confirmed by Uganda’s First Deputy Prime Minister and Minister of EAC Rebecca Kadaga on Monday.

“I have received the sad news of the death of Hassan Galiwango, our Ambassador to the Republic of Kenya. On behalf of @GovUganda, I send our deepest condolences to his family, the NRM party and Ministry of Foreign Affairs,” Kedaga tweeted.

The deceased was the husband of Ugandan MP Connie Galiwango Nakayenze.

Reports indicate that Wasswa was airlifted to Nairobi Hospital after falling sick three days ago.

Kenya’s Cabinet Secretary for Foreign and Diaspora Affairs Alfred Mutua also sent his condolences to the family.

“My condolences to the President, Government and the people of Uganda on the passing of Ugandan High Commissioner to Kenya, Dr. Hassan Wasswa Galiwango, who passed away this morning in Nairobi Hospital. My deepest sympathies to his family. Rest In Peace Ndugu,” Mutua tweeted.

Prior to his appointment as High Commissioner in October 2020, Wasswa served as the National Resistance Movement (NRM) secretariat’s director of finance and administration.
